Construction electrical wiring services involve installing, upgrading, and repairing the electrical systems within a property. This work ensures that homes and commercial buildings have a safe, reliable flow of electricity to power lighting, appliances, outlets, and other electrical devices. Skilled service providers handle tasks such as running new wiring during renovations, replacing outdated wiring, and installing circuits that meet the specific needs of the property. Proper wiring is essential for the overall functionality of a building and helps prevent electrical issues that could lead to outages or hazards.

Many common electrical problems can be addressed through these services. For example, flickering lights, frequent circuit breaker trips, or outlets that no longer work may indicate wiring issues or overloads. Older properties often have wiring systems that are no longer up to code or capable of supporting modern electrical demands. Upgrading or repairing the wiring can resolve these problems, improve safety, and ensure that the electrical system can handle increased power loads from new appliances or technology. Service providers can assess existing wiring and recommend solutions to improve performance and safety.

Construction electrical wiring is used in a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-family residences, commercial buildings, and renovations of older structures. New construction projects require complete wiring installations to set up electrical infrastructure from the ground up. Existing properties undergoing remodeling or expansion may need wiring upgrades to accommodate additional outlets, lighting, or modern electrical systems. Whether it’s a residential property or a commercial space, professional wiring services are essential for creating a safe and functional electrical environment.

The overview below groups typical Construction Electrical Wiring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or electrical wiring repairs or upgrades range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end depending on complexity.

Lighting Installations - Installing new lighting fixtures or wiring for a few rooms usually costs between $500 and $2,000. Larger or more intricate lighting projects can increase the total, but most fall into the lower to mid-range estimates.

Full Wiring Replacement - Replacing all electrical wiring in a home or large space generally costs from $3,000 to $8,000. More extensive, complex rewires can exceed $10,000, though these are less common.

Commercial Electrical Projects - Commercial wiring services typically range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the size and scope of the project. Smaller commercial jobs tend to be at the lower end, with larger, complex projects reaching higher tiers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
